Miyahara Eye Clinic - Founded during the Japanese colonial period in the 1930s, it was the largest hospital in Taichung at that time. Its founder was Japanese physician Takeo Miyahara. After Taiwan's retrocession, Takeo Miyahara was repatriated to Japan, and his eye clinic became government property, changing ownership. Decades later, the Miyahara Eye Clinic building suffered severe damage from the 921 earthquake and Typhoon Morakot, leaving the entire building dilapidated and severely damaged. In 2010, Dawn Cake, a famous pineapple cake shop in Taichung, purchased the building, renovated and redecorated it. The interior was completely rebuilt, while some elements of the exterior and the arcade were preserved, along with the "Miyahara Eye Clinic" sign. The old building's fate was successfully reshaped, transforming it into an exquisite commercial space selling pastries, beverages, desserts, and more.
